Abstract

Bakmi Tjoi is a micro, small, and medium enterprise (MSME) in the culinary sector that still applies a manual ordering process. This process often causes queues at the cashier area, slows down services, and increases the risk of recording errors. This study aims to develop a web-based self-ordering information system using the Laravel framework to improve the efficiency of the ordering process at Bakmi Tjoi. The system was developed using the Rapid Application Development (RAD) method because it supports fast development through an iterative approach. The system was built using Laravel and MySQL and integrated with the Midtrans payment gateway to support online payments. In addition, the system is equipped with a QR Code feature that allows customers to access the ordering page through smartphones. System testing was conducted using Black Box Testing and User Acceptance Test (UAT). The results indicate that the developed system is capable of improving the ordering process to become faster and more integrated. Based on Time on Task testing, the average ordering process using the system ranged from 4 to 8 minutes, which is faster than the previous manual ordering process that required approximately 5 to 10 minutes.
